In high school I pretty much had the politics of everyone else around me, which was a kind of Moderate Hero, Daily Show-esque, "why can't they all be reasonable" inanity. I probably would have described myself as "economically centrist, socially liberal". As an undergrad I became a bit of a SJW, with a particular interest in feminism, but after a while I found that unsatisfactory and moved economically to the left, to the point where I was pretty much a Marxist. Since then, I've moved slightly back towards the centre - or at least, become much more pragmatic.
